About D. E. Franke

D. E. Franke is a scholar working on Genetics, Agronomy and Crop Science, Animal Science and Zoology, Small Animals and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, having authored 53 papers that have together received 1.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Genetic and phenotypic traits in livestock (35 papers), Ruminant Nutrition and Digestive Physiology (14 papers), Genetic Mapping and Diversity in Plants and Animals (11 papers), Animal Nutrition and Physiology (9 papers), Reproductive Physiology in Livestock (9 papers), Meat and Animal Product Quality (8 papers), Rabbits: Nutrition, Reproduction, Health (3 papers) and Diet and metabolism studies (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Agronomy and Crop Science (537 citations), Animal Science and Zoology (474 citations), Genetics (704 citations), Small Animals (186 citations) and Obstetrics and Gynecology (49 citations). D. E. Franke has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Algeria and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include W.W. Thatcher, J. W. Knight, Fuller W. Bazer, H. D. Wallace, S. M. DeRouen, T. D. Bidner, David C. Blouin, Michael E. Dikeman, P. E. Humes and W. E. Wyatt.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Animal Science, American Journal of Primatology, Journal of Heredity, Veterinary Immunology and Immunopathology and Veterinary Parasitology.
